Parks Bowen's Obituary
Parks Bowen, 95, of Cornelius was called to heaven on May 24, 2012. He was born on November 16, 1916 to Ella Zarrad and William Bowen. Mr. Bowen and his wife were owners and operators of Bowens Beauty Nook in Charlotte for 25 years. He lived on Lake Norman until his health declined. He is a WWII Veteran and dearly loved to tell his war stories. He loved his church and family. He taught Sunday School for many years at Garr Memorial Church. He enjoyed singing and playing his guitar. In later years he attended Grace Covenant Church. His love for people was never ending. He loved nothing better than to tell jokes and make people laugh. His family thanks him for leaving them with many memories. “We will always love you.”
He was preceded in death by his lovely wife of 57 years Geneva and his beloved daughter-in-law Elizabeth Bowen.
He is survived by his son Don Bowen and wife Debbie of Cornelius; daughter, Ginger Childress and husband Jimmy of Cornelius; grandchildren, Holly (and husband Scott) and Fonda (and husband Kenny), Kevin (and wife Hope) and Melissa and 8 great-grandchildren.
